Early Life in Florence: A Childhood in the Heart of Tuscany
Fabio Viviani was born on October 10, 1978, in Florence, the cultural and culinary capital of Tuscany, Italy. Raised in a working-class neighborhood surrounded by cobblestone streets, bustling markets, and trattorias, Fabio’s earliest memories are saturated with the scents of simmering tomato sauce, freshly baked focaccia, and roasting garlic. Florence wasn’t just his hometown—it was his first teacher. The rhythm of the city, its flavors, and its rituals embedded in him a love for food that went far beyond nourishment.
Born to a modest family, Fabio’s home life was simple but rich in tradition. His mother, a homemaker with an intuitive understanding of Tuscan cooking, often prepared meals from scratch using seasonal produce and cherished family recipes. His grandmother, a firm but loving matriarch, taught him how to make pasta by hand and instilled in him the core values of patience, humility, and respect for ingredients.
At just 11 years old, driven by both necessity and ambition, Fabio took up work at a local bakery. Every morning before school, he would rise before dawn to knead dough, sweep flour-dusted counters, and assist in baking pastries. Though he was still a child, he quickly stood out for his discipline and hunger to learn. This experience awakened a fierce passion for cooking—and introduced him to the organized chaos of professional kitchens.
By 16, Fabio had risen to the rank of sous-chef at Il Pallaio, a popular trattoria known for its traditional wood-fired meats and rustic Italian fare. There, he honed his skills in classical Italian techniques, worked long shifts side-by-side with seasoned chefs, and learned to manage a team. The confidence, grit, and leadership he demonstrated as a teenager would later define his global culinary legacy.

Rise to Fame: Top Chef and the Turning Point
Chef Fabio Viviani’s life changed dramatically in 2008, when he appeared on Bravo’s Top Chef – Season 5. With his warm personality, sharp wit, and unapologetically Italian charm, he quickly became a fan favorite—eventually earning the “Fan Favorite” title. Though he finished fourth in the competition, Fabio left a lasting impression on viewers and industry professionals alike.
His phrases like “this is Top Chef, not Top Scallop” became instant classics. But more importantly, he showcased a refined yet relatable approach to Italian cuisine. His confidence and competence in the kitchen, even under pressure, earned him invitations to return for Top Chef: All-Stars (Season 8) and other culinary specials.
Top Chef catapulted Fabio from a regional restaurateur to a national culinary personality, opening doors to media appearances, publishing deals, and massive hospitality ventures.
Fabio Viviani Hospitality: Building an Empire
Following his television success, Chef Fabio launched Fabio Viviani Hospitality (FVH)—a comprehensive restaurant group that would go on to operate and manage over 30 restaurants across the United States. His vision extended beyond traditional dining. Fabio believed in creating “an experience”—a fusion of ambiance, service, and comfort food with flair.
Key Restaurant Concepts:
- Siena Tavern (Chicago, IL): A modern Italian favorite known for its wood-fired pizzas, house-made pastas, and upscale bar program.
- Bar Siena (Chicago, IL): Casual, vibrant, and designed for communal Italian-style dining.
- Osteria OKC (Oklahoma City, OK): An elevated yet approachable Italian dining destination in Nichols Hills.
- Taverna Costale (St. Petersburg, FL): Coastal Italian cuisine with fresh seafood, launched in January 2022.
- Bar Cicchetti (Columbus, OH and other locations): Small-plate Italian concept with locations in Illinois, Pennsylvania, and Tennessee.
Under his leadership, FVH served over 10 million meals annually, establishing itself as one of the fastest-growing independent hospitality groups in America.
📚 Author, Mentor, and Kitchen Philosopher
Chef Fabio Viviani is not only a cook—he is a storyteller. His love for food has been expressed through the written word, resulting in multiple best-selling cookbooks:
- Cafe Firenze Cookbook (2009): A blend of rustic recipes and modern culinary techniques.
- Fabio’s Italian Kitchen (2013): A New York Times Bestseller that combines family stories with classic Italian recipes.
- Fabio’s American Home Kitchen (2014): A celebration of Italian-American fusion cuisine tailored for U.S. households.
Through his books, Fabio not only shared recipes but offered readers a glimpse into the soul of Italian cooking—its emphasis on simplicity, seasonality, and emotional connection.
🎥 Media and Television: Cooking with Charisma
Chef Fabio Viviani’s magnetism extended far beyond the kitchen. His television and online presence solidified his status as a culinary entertainer and educator. Some of his most notable media ventures include:
- Chow Ciao! – An award-winning web series on Yahoo! where Fabio cooked Italian classics with a modern twist. The show won a Webby Award in 2012.
- Fabio’s Kitchen – A long-running digital series showcasing Viviani’s approach to family meals, entertaining tips, and guest appearances.
- Frequent guest spots on Good Morning America, The Rachael Ray Show, and The Chew.
- Winner of Cutthroat Kitchen All-Star Tournament on Food Network, proving his competitive skills remain razor-sharp.
Viviani’s on-screen persona made him a household name, not just among food lovers but mainstream audiences, making cooking both fun and educational.

Corporate Dining & Expansion
Fabio’s impact also extended into the corporate dining and food service space. In partnership with Market District and Giant Eagle, he launched Osteria by Fabio Viviani, beginning in Carmel, Indiana, with further expansions planned. These ventures aim to elevate in-store dining experiences and bring chef-driven menus to broader audiences.
Fabio’s ability to straddle fine dining and casual service—while maintaining consistent quality—has made him a sought-after collaborator in both private and institutional hospitality sectors.
